LOOK Musical Theatre stars sang for their supper during the organization's annual Holiday Supper Gala held recently at the University of Tulsa's Lorton Performance Center.

LOOK, which celebrates its 30th anniversary in 2013, presents musicals and cabarets in the summer in repertory fashion using talent from all over the country, some of which was on display at the gala. Cabaret favorite Andrea Leap entertained guests with "Ribbons down my Back" from "Hello, Dolly!" Northeastern State University voice faculty member Shannon Unger sang an aria from Rossini's "The Italian Girl in Algiers."

Other performers included Patrick Howle, Nicholas Hunter, Stephen Glasco, Stephen Dagrosa, and LOOK mainstay April Golliver who collaborated with cellist Kari Caldwell on a Leonard Bernstein piece titled "Dream of Me." Artistic Director Eric Gibson hosted the evening and led the entertainment from the piano.

On the stage of the performance center, patrons viewed items in a silent auction as classical guitarist Randy Wimer serenaded them with traditional holiday music. Guests were then ushered into the lobby, doused in purple lights and enjoyed holiday arrangements created by Toni's Flowers. The dinner menu was created by the university's executive chef, Tim Anderson.

Benefits from the Holiday Supper provide support for the LOOK 2013 season, which will feature the great Jerry Herman musical "Hello, Dolly!" which starred the effervescent Carol Channing. LOOK's production of "Dolly" and the company's other offerings will run June and July 2013 at the Tulsa Performing Arts Center.
